What is workflow automation?

Every maintenance team follows processes to get work done. A workflow refers to the sequence of actions required to complete a process. 

Workflow automation is the practice of identifying, standardizing, and automating routine tasks with software designed to maximize productivity. It’s about eliminating "low-value" tasks with technology systems. Smart workflows cut down on mistakes and help teams work faster.

For maintenance managers, workflow automation is particularly effective for streamlining work order management. Work order software relieves maintenance technicians of time-consuming administrative tasks to focus on what they do best—keeping equipment running.

How workflow automation works

Workflow automation uses rule-based logic to carry out a sequence of tasks without human intervention. The process uses triggers and actions. A trigger is an event that starts the workflow, and an action is the task that the system performs automatically.

For example, in a maintenance setting, a trigger could be an asset's sensor reading exceeding a temperature threshold. This event automatically starts a series of actions:

  • The system creates a work order to inspect the overheating asset.
  • The platform assigns the work order to a technician with the right skills.
  • The software sends a notification to the maintenance manager about the high-priority task.

This automated process replaces manual steps like filling out paper forms, making phone calls, and updating spreadsheets, allowing your team to respond to issues faster.

Benefits of workflow automation for maintenance operations

Automating your maintenance workflows provides several benefits that directly impact your team's performance and your company's bottom line.

Increased productivity

When you automate work order generation, your team can focus on higher-level work instead of paperwork. That productivity boost affects other departments, too.

Enhanced accountability

Workflow automation allows you to easily assign tasks to specific technicians and monitor their performance in real time. When everyone on the team knows who is responsible for what job, it becomes easier to hold workers accountable and ensure they complete work on time.

Improved quality control

Automated workflows give technicians clear step-by-step guidance. Team members know exactly what managers expect, which improves work quality. This is especially helpful for new hires.

Minimized human error

According to a Plant Engineering maintenance survey, operator error accounted for 11 percent of unexpected outages in facilities.

Process automation eliminates common human errors like:

  • Forgetting to submit critical work requests
  • Entering incorrect asset data or part numbers
  • Missing scheduled preventive maintenance tasks
  • Losing paper-based documentation

Increased work satisfaction

Work satisfaction plays a vital role in employee retention. Employees who feel unchallenged are likely to look for work elsewhere. That's not something you want, considering the growing skilled labor gap in maintenance.

Automating mundane administrative tasks increases job satisfaction by allowing technicians to focus on challenging and engaging projects.

Types of workflow automation for industrial operations

Maintenance teams can automate several types of workflows. A maintenance manager at a food processing facility might automate safety inspections to ensure Food and Drug Administration (FDA) compliance, while a plant manager in manufacturing could focus on automating PM schedules for production-critical equipment like packaging machines.

Common examples include:

  • Work order management: The system automates the entire lifecycle of a maintenance task, from creation and assignment to tracking and completion. 
  • Preventive maintenance scheduling: The platform automatically generates preventive maintenance (PM) work orders based on a set schedule (e.g., every 30 days) or equipment usage (e.g., every 500 operating hours). This ensures teams never miss PMs.
  • Inventory management: The software sets up triggers to automatically create a purchase request when the quantity of a critical spare part drops below a specified minimum. This helps prevent stockouts and production delays.
  • Safety and compliance inspections: The system schedules and assigns routine safety inspections automatically. This ensures teams complete all required checks. The system then stores digital records of this for compliance audits.

Workflow automation examples in maintenance

While workflow automation applies across many departments, it offers especially powerful benefits for maintenance teams. 

1. Employee recruitment and onboarding

For maintenance teams, automated processes help filter candidates and streamline onboarding workflows.

You can use workflow automation software to assign safety training, tool check-outs, and Standard Operating Procedures (SOPs) to new technicians automatically. This ensures every hire receives consistent preparation from day one.

2. Work requests

Maintenance teams must resolve work requests quickly, especially in manufacturing facilities. Without an automated workflow, teams can easily lose or delay requests.

Computerized maintenance management system (CMMS) software can help teams automate the entire work request process:

  • Digital submission: Employees submit requests online through mobile devices
  • Automatic routing: The system sends requests directly to the right approver based on priority or asset type
  • Instant conversion: Approved requests automatically become assigned work orders
  • Real-time tracking: Managers receive alerts and monitor progress from submission to completion

Workflow automation for maintenance teams FAQs

What maintenance workflows should manufacturing facilities automate first?

Start with high-impact, repetitive processes like preventive maintenance scheduling and automated work request routing from operators to maintenance teams. These workflows typically show return on investment within weeks of implementation.

Can workflow automation integrate with our existing enterprise resource planning system in manufacturing?

Yes, leading CMMS platforms offer integration capabilities with popular enterprise resource planning (ERP) systems like SAP, Oracle, and Microsoft Dynamics. This allows automated workflows to sync inventory data, purchase orders, and financial reporting across your operation.
